Banking/Finance
|
Updated on 05 Nov 2025, 11:46 am
Reviewed By
Satyam Jha | Whalesbook News Team
▶
Mahindra & Mahindra Limited (M&M) is divesting its entire 3.45% holding in RBL Bank, a transaction expected to fetch ₹682 crore. The sale is being executed via a block deal with a floor price set at ₹317 per share, which is about 2.1% lower than RBL Bank's prevailing market rate. This strategic exit allows Mahindra & Mahindra to realize a substantial 64% return on its initial investment of ₹417 crore made in July 2023, when it acquired a minority stake at ₹197 per share.
This divestment signifies the automaker's complete withdrawal from its investment in the private lender, occurring just over a year after the initial stake acquisition. Mahindra & Mahindra's Managing Director and CEO, Anish Shah, had previously indicated in August 2023 that the company had no intention of increasing its stake, viewing the investment primarily as a means to gain deeper insights into the banking sector and enhance shareholder value. The sale concludes M&M's brief but profitable engagement with RBL Bank.
Impact: This news is likely to have a moderate impact on the stock prices of both Mahindra & Mahindra and RBL Bank. RBL Bank might see some short-term pressure due to the large stake sale, while Mahindra & Mahindra might see a positive reaction for exiting a non-core investment profitably. The overall market sentiment towards banking stocks and auto ancillary investments could also be subtly influenced. Rating: 6/10
Difficult Terms: Block Deal: A large transaction of shares that is privately negotiated between two parties (buyer and seller) rather than being traded on the open market. It is usually executed at a predetermined price. Floor Price: The lowest price at which a seller is willing to sell a security. In a block deal, it sets the minimum price per share for the transaction. Market Capitalisation (Market Cap): The total market value of a company's outstanding shares of stock. It is calculated by multiplying the total number of shares by the current market price of one share. Minority Stake: Ownership of less than 50% of a company's voting stock, meaning the shareholder does not have control over the company's decisions.